David Yaari is a prominent American-Israeli entrepreneur with a diverse range of professional and philanthropic pursuits. His business career has been marked by key leadership roles, including his position as the Founding Director General of the Arizona-Israel Trade and Investment Office. This role has enabled him to foster economic ties between the two regions. Additionally, Yaari has been involved in various community organizations, demonstrating his commitment to both business and social causes.

Yaari's influence extends to several notable boards and organizations. He serves as the chairman of the World Confederation of United Zionists and is a member of the board of Keren Kayemet LeYisrael (KKL) - Jewish National Fund (JNF). His involvement in education is also evident through his role on the Board of Directors of StellarNova, an education technology company focused on STEM fields. Recognized for his significant contributions, Yaari was named one of the "Forward 50" most influential Jewish Americans by The Jewish Daily Forward in 2008, a testament to his impact on both the business and philanthropic communities.
